当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

google服务器框架下载,深入解析Google服务器框架,架构、原理与实践

google服务器框架下载,深入解析Google服务器框架,架构、原理与实践

深入解析Google服务器框架,本文详细介绍了其架构、原理与实践。涵盖框架下载、安装及配置,探讨核心组件和关键技术,帮助读者全面掌握Google服务器框架的运用。...

深入解析google服务器框架,本文详细介绍了其架构、原理与实践。涵盖框架下载、安装及配置,探讨核心组件和关键技术,帮助读者全面掌握Google服务器框架的运用。

随着互联网技术的飞速发展,服务器架构逐渐成为企业关注的焦点,Google作为全球领先的技术公司,其服务器框架在业界享有极高的声誉,本文将从Google服务器框架的架构、原理和实践三个方面进行深入剖析,旨在为广大开发者提供有益的参考。

Google服务器框架架构

1、模块化设计

Google服务器框架采用模块化设计,将整个系统划分为多个独立模块,如前端模块、后端模块、存储模块等,这种设计使得系统具有良好的可扩展性和可维护性。

google服务器框架下载,深入解析Google服务器框架,架构、原理与实践

2、轻量级服务器

Google服务器框架采用轻量级服务器设计,通过优化内存和CPU资源,提高系统性能,轻量级服务器通常采用异步编程模型,能够实现更高的并发处理能力。

3、高可用性设计

Google服务器框架采用高可用性设计,通过分布式存储、负载均衡等技术,确保系统在面临故障时能够快速恢复,保障业务连续性。

4、安全性设计

Google服务器框架注重安全性设计,采用多种安全机制,如SSL/TLS加密、访问控制等,确保系统数据安全。

Google服务器框架原理

1、MapReduce

MapReduce是Google服务器框架的核心组件之一,主要用于大规模数据处理,它将数据处理任务分解为Map和Reduce两个阶段,通过分布式计算实现高效的数据处理。

google服务器框架下载,深入解析Google服务器框架,架构、原理与实践

2、GFS(Google File System)

GFS是Google服务器框架的分布式文件系统,用于存储大规模数据,GFS具有高可靠性、高吞吐量和可扩展性等特点,适用于大数据场景。

3、Bigtable

Bigtable是Google服务器框架的分布式数据库,用于存储非关系型数据,Bigtable具有高性能、高可用性和可扩展性等特点,适用于海量数据存储。

4、GFS for Logs

GFS for Logs是Google服务器框架的日志存储系统,用于存储和分析系统日志,GFS for Logs具有高可靠性、高吞吐量和可扩展性等特点,适用于大规模日志存储。

Google服务器框架实践

1、分布式存储

在Google服务器框架中,分布式存储是核心组成部分,通过使用GFS、Bigtable等组件,可以实现海量数据的存储和管理。

google服务器框架下载,深入解析Google服务器框架,架构、原理与实践

2、负载均衡

Google服务器框架采用负载均衡技术,将请求分发到多个服务器,提高系统并发处理能力,常见的负载均衡算法包括轮询、最少连接数、IP哈希等。

3、异步编程

Google服务器框架采用异步编程模型,提高系统性能,通过异步编程,可以实现高并发、低延迟的数据处理。

4、安全性保障

Google服务器框架注重安全性保障,采用多种安全机制,如SSL/TLS加密、访问控制等,确保系统数据安全。

Google服务器框架在业界具有极高的声誉,其架构、原理和实践对广大开发者具有重要的参考价值,本文从架构、原理和实践三个方面对Google服务器框架进行了深入剖析,旨在为广大开发者提供有益的参考,在实际应用中,可以根据自身业务需求,借鉴Google服务器框架的优势,构建高效、稳定、安全的服务器架构。

黑狐家游戏

发表评论

最新文章